Can't go wrong with anything that has already been discussed here, but will add that I use a pellet grill and I won't be going back to anything else any time soon.

I purchased a RecTec grill last year and it's basically cheating. You set the temp and forget it. With the technology, you put the temp gauge in the meat and you never have to lift the lid.

They're a little pricey when comparing to a Traeger or other brands, but their service and parts are superior (plus they're local for me and I wanted to support local business).
